5 steps in the decision making process - Answer-1) recognizing existing needs 2)
identifying alternatives to fulfill needs 3) evaluating identified alternatives 4) selecting
and implementing alternatives 5) reflecting on and evaluating the alternatives selected

5-Step Decision-Making Model Ch. 1 - Answer-A flexible decision-making framework
that incorporates recognizing existing needs, identifying alternatives to fulfill needs,
evaluating identified alternatives, selecting and implementing alternatives, and reflecting
on and evaluating the alternatives selected

Explain the different family theories from Ch. 2 - Answer-Family System Theory: When
something happens to one of the family members, all the family is affected.
Social Exchange Theory: Family relationships become interdependent, or interactional.
Symbolic interactionism: families reinforce and rejuvenate bonds through symbolic
rituals such as family meals and holidays.
Conflict Theory: focuses on the way in which members of the family struggle for
different aspects of life. This includes the struggle for resources and power.
Family Development Theory: focuses on the systematic and patterned changes
experienced by families as they move through their life course

Four key managerial concepts proposed by Henry Fayol Ch.3 - Answer-Plan
Organize
Lead
Control

Maslow's Hierarchy of Needs and an example of both Ch.4 - Answer-Maslow's theory of
motivation, which states that we must achieve lower-level needs, such as food, shelter,
and safety before we can achieve higher-level needs, such as belonging, esteem, and
self-actualization.

Consumer Resource Exchange Model and how it differs from Maslow's Hierarchy of
Needs Ch.4 - Answer-Four basic assumptions are made and theoretically justified. This
differs from Maslow's Hierarchy of needs because Maslow sees food and shelter as
lower levels and focuses more on the internal than the external.

List the four preconditions necessary for society before needs are met Ch.4 - Answer-
Product, Reproduction, cultural transmission, and authority

Name the four dimensions of human betterment according to Boulding Ch.5 - Answer-
Economic adequacy, justice, freedom, and peacefulness.
